The lowdown: Lavish Bal Harbour plays host to Stella McCartney’s fifth freestanding store in the United States — and her first in Florida. Best known for her sleek, structural garbs with an eco edge, the Brit It designer celebrated the store’s opening with a Christie’s-hosted soiree showcasing show-stopping precious jewels. Also on display? Shown here are models wearing the new evening collection only previously shown in London.
The ambience: McCartney’s Bal Harbour door renders bespoke, sustainable oak-parquet floors laid in a traditional herringbone pattern displaying the designer’s favorite hues of plums, pale pinks, blush, nude and taupe. The jackpot at the end of this rainbow? The shop leads into a circular area filled with heels, lingerie and a playful children’s section.
Highlights: The store carries the brand’s luxury women’s ready-to-wear, shoes, bags, sunglasses, intimates and kid’s collection. The pièce de résistance? A McCartney-designed exclusive palm tree necklace ($375).
